breathing system

lungs are protected by the ribs and intercostal muscles run in between the ribs (external and internal). the air you breathe in goes through the larynx and down the trachea(hollow tubes with c shaped rings of cartilages that give structure but also movement), splitting into bronchi(bronchus) and then into smaller bronchioles, being absorbed by al

2
New cards

thorax

middle section of your body(lungs and ribs)

3
New cards

ventilation

breathing in(inspiration) and then breathing out(expiration)

4
New cards

inspiration

external intercostal and diaphragm contract causing ribs to move outwards and forwards which increases volume and pulls air in

5
New cards

expiration

internal intercostals muscles contract causing the ribs to move downwards and inwards increasing pressure in thorax which pushes air out

6
New cards

alveoli

in the lungs and are optimized for gas exchange. they have a large surface area, thin surface, good blood supply, good ventilation

7
New cards

how are the breathing systems protected

airways are lined with ciliated cells that are covered in cilia that waft the mucus up the throat to be swallowed, and goblet cells that produce the mucus that the pathogens stick to. on the trachea and bronchi

8
New cards

7 things energy is needed for in the body

muscles to contact, protein synthesis, cell division(mitosis, meiosis), active transport, cell growth, passing impulses along neurons, maintain a constant body temperature

9
New cards

aerobic respiration

series of chemical reactions that happen in cells and use oxygen to break down nutrient molecules to release energy(C6H12O6 → 6CO2 + 6H2O)

10
New cards

anaerobic respiration

reactions in cells that break down nutrient molecules to release energy without using oxygen(glucose → lactic acid). much less efficient than aerobic respiration

11
New cards

oxygen debt

when your body cant supply enough oxygen to your muscles under severe load anaerobic respiration starts happening. this creates debt since the generated lactic acid needs more oxygen to get broken down in the liver. heart rate also stays high to transport the acid from muscles to the liver, where it is broken down through aerobic respiration
